One corpse. 46,600 suspects.
Okay, a bit standard, but there is a corpse in Alice Starling's apartment. The police are pretty sure: she, Alice, did it.
Only… Alice says she didn't.
In fact, she claims she can prove she is innocent. Provided you help her.
And that's where the addiction begins… Now.want.to.
With 18 clues, a file full of evidence and no less than 46,600 suspects you will cross off names step by step. Until only one person remains: the real murderer. Perfect for your days at the beach.
